Understanding Content Repurposing as a Core Component

Content repurposing, central to the concept of spinsala, is the practice of taking existing content – a blog post, webinar, ebook, or even a social media update – and transforming it into new formats. This isn't about simply copy-pasting; it’s about adapting the core message for a different medium and audience segment. The benefits are numerous, including increased reach, improved SEO, and a more efficient use of marketing resources. A single piece of high-quality content can be spun into multiple assets, significantly expanding its lifespan and impact. For example, a detailed blog post outlining industry trends can be distilled into a series of social media snippets, a short video script, and an infographic, each targeting a different part of the audience with a tailored message.

The Strategic Value of Format Diversification

Diversifying content formats is key to reaching a wider audience and catering to different learning preferences. Some individuals prefer reading in-depth articles, while others prefer watching videos or listening to podcasts. By offering content in multiple formats, you increase the likelihood of connecting with potential customers and capturing their attention. Investing in tools and platforms that facilitate format conversion – such as video editing software, infographic creators, and audio recording equipment – is essential. Furthermore, consider the platform when repurposing content; a LinkedIn audience will respond differently to content than a TikTok audience, requiring tailored messaging and presentations.

Original Content Repurposed Formats Platform Examples
Blog Post Infographic, Video Script, Podcast Outline, Social Media Series Website, YouTube, Spotify, LinkedIn, Facebook
Webinar Blog Post Recap, Short Video Clips, Presentation Slides, Email Newsletter Website, YouTube, LinkedIn, Mailchimp
Ebook Blog Post Series, Social Media Quotes, Webinar Content, Lead Magnet Website, LinkedIn, Twitter, Email

The effective use of a content calendar is crucial when planning content repurposing. It allows marketers to proactively identify opportunities to transform existing assets and schedule their release across different platforms, ensuring a consistent and engaging content flow. This proactive approach to content creation maximizes impact and minimizes wasted effort.

Leveraging Spinsala Principles for Enhanced SEO

Search Engine Optimization (SEO) is a cornerstone of digital marketing success. Approaches that incorporate the spirit of spinsala can significantly boost a website’s search engine rankings. By repurposing content into different formats, you increase the opportunities for keyword targeting and link building. For example, a video transcript can provide valuable textual content for search engines to index, while an infographic can attract backlinks from other websites. Furthermore, by consistently publishing fresh and relevant content, even in repurposed form, you signal to search engines that your website is active and authoritative.

Keyword Research & Content Adaptation

Before repurposing any content, it's crucial to conduct thorough keyword research to identify relevant terms and phrases that your target audience is searching for. Then, adapt the content accordingly, ensuring that these keywords are naturally integrated into the new format. This doesn’t mean keyword stuffing; it means using keywords strategically to improve search visibility. Tools like Google Keyword Planner, SEMrush, and Ahrefs can provide valuable insights into keyword trends and search volume. Consideration of long-tail keywords is also recommended, as they often have lower competition and can attract highly targeted traffic.

  • Optimize Titles & Descriptions: Ensure each repurposed piece has a compelling title and meta description that includes relevant keywords.
  • Image Alt Text: Use descriptive alt text for all images, incorporating keywords where appropriate.
  • Internal Linking: Link between your repurposed content pieces to create a cohesive web of information and improve site navigation.
  • External Linking: Link to authoritative sources to establish credibility and build relationships with other websites.

Remember that SEO is an ongoing process, requiring continuous monitoring and optimization. Track your keyword rankings, website traffic, and conversion rates to assess the effectiveness of your spinsala-informed SEO strategy and make necessary adjustments.

The Role of Social Media in Amplifying Spinsala Efforts

Social media platforms are powerful tools for amplifying the reach of repurposed content. Each platform has its unique characteristics and audience demographics, so it’s essential to tailor your content accordingly. What works well on LinkedIn might not resonate on TikTok, and vice versa. For instance, a long-form blog post can be broken down into a series of bite-sized social media updates, each with a captivating image or video. Interactive content formats, such as polls, quizzes, and live streams, can also be highly effective in driving engagement.

Platform-Specific Content Strategies

Developing platform-specific content strategies is crucial for maximizing social media impact. Consider the following: LinkedIn is ideal for sharing professional insights and industry news. Twitter is best suited for short, concise updates and engaging in real-time conversations. Facebook is a versatile platform for sharing a variety of content formats, including articles, videos, and images. Instagram is focused on visual content, making it perfect for sharing photos, videos, and Stories. TikTok favors short-form videos and challenges. Tailoring your content to each platform’s strengths will significantly increase your chances of reaching your target audience and achieving your marketing goals.

  1. Consistency is Key: Maintain a regular posting schedule to keep your audience engaged.
  2. Engage with Your Audience: Respond to comments and messages promptly and participate in relevant conversations.
  3. Use Hashtags Strategically: Research relevant hashtags to increase the visibility of your content.
  4. Track Your Results: Monitor your social media analytics to measure your performance and identify areas for improvement.

Social listening – monitoring social media channels for mentions of your brand, industry keywords, and competitor activity – can also provide valuable insights for informing your spinsala strategy.
